| % When fabric is configured with eunit_run=true it will ask erlfdb for a |
| % test database. The default behavior for erlfdb in this case is start a |
| % new fdbserver process for the test. If you would rather have erlfdb |
| % connect to an existing FoundationDB cluster, you can supply the path |
| % to the cluster file as a binary string here. |
| % |
| % NOTE: the unit tests will erase all the data in the cluster! |
| % |
| % The docker-compose configuration in the .devcontainer activates this |
| % application setting using ERL_ZFLAGS in the container environment, so |
| % any tests will use the fdbserver running in the fdb container. |
| % {erlfdb, [{test_cluster_file, <<"/usr/local/etc/foundationdb/fdb.cluster">>}]}, |
